Is it related to performance as more characters are compared? > otherwise semantic wise they will get the expected response, correct? kstrtobool() returned -EINVAL for "true"/"false" strings before this patch. It will successfully handle them after this patch. This is a behavior/functional change that will affect all existing kstrtobool() callers. The change makes sense and most likely will not cause any regression. But are you 100% sure? Yes, the 1st character is enough to distinguish "true" and "false". Two characters are needed for "on" and "off" because the 1st character is the same. Best Regards, Petr
